Transaction ef38fca1805564063d9b9e738824e0fcfe8b7fc6001082d1cb54f0a211853930
1 Input
1 Output
-
ef38fca1805564063d9b9e738824e0fcfe8b7fc6001082d1cb54f0a211853930:0
- value
- 710000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d24570da7baf28db3b137a76fb9608e810dacb76 OP_EQUAL
- address
- 3Lrq1fLkCkNPT4GpkAs2M5XTxGBKF7U4CU